Little Fiona 2002 - 2016

  • Gender: Female
  • Birthday: September 10, 2002
  • Arrival: July 1, 2015
  • Deceased: August 8, 2016
  • Background: Research
  • Character: Social

From birth Fiona had a happy, soft, positive personality and was a social butterfly with her caregivers. She loved to watch us go about our daily duties and when she wanted our attention or we looked in her direction she would wiggle her ears to catch and hold our glance. She lived in the lab and at Jungle Friends with her lifelong friends Ingrid, Blue, Georgia, Greta, Magy, Tilda, and Hana. She was especially close to Georgia and Tilda and the three were often seen napping together midday after hectic mornings spent eating, playing, and socializing.  Oranges were one of Fiona’s favorite foods and she ate them with gusto as you can see in the picture. In early July Fiona was diagnosed with an aggressive form of cancer that was not treatable and would shorten her life significantly.  Throughout her 14 years I loved her, protected her, and did everything possible to give her a long and enriched life.  It was a deep heartbreak when we said goodbye on August 8th.  The years I shared with Fiona will remain with me and I’ll keep her close in mind and heart by recalling memories of her wiggling those adorable ears when we looked into each others eyes.

I wholeheartedly thank Fiona’s dedicated caregivers at JF who loved her, fussed over her, and gave her the intensive care she needed during this illness to live a good life as long as possible.
